The Song of the Grey Pigeon

1961 · 98 min Drama War
5.9 / 10 · TMDB

An unusual children's film set during World War II in Czechoslovakia, this compelling drama unfolds five different segments that present the war through the eyes of three youngsters. The three have a series of adventures which include saving a soldier from being captured by the Germans, helping out the resistance fighters, and meeting up with a young Russian woman trained in guerrilla warfare. As they learn more about life and danger, various circumstances constantly recall the reality of war itself. The title comes from a wounded pigeon under the care of one of the youngsters.

📋 Film Details

Original Title Pieseň o sivom holubovi
Year 1961
Country Czechoslovakia
Genre Drama, War
Director Stanislav Barabáš
Runtime 98 min.
